How they compare
Cambodia currently reports 60,460 US dollar per square kilometre against 52,665 US dollar per square kilometre in Iceland, a difference of 7,795 US dollar per square kilometre.
That makes Cambodia's figure about 1.1 times Iceland's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 29 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Iceland ahead.
Cambodia ranks 103rd and Iceland ranks 105th of 169 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Cambodia averaged higher in 1 and Iceland in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cambodia | Iceland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 3,141 US dollar per square kilometre | 3,273 US dollar per square kilometre | 132.13 US dollar per square kilometre | Iceland |
| 2000s | 15,034 US dollar per square kilometre | 140,760 US dollar per square kilometre | 125,726 US dollar per square kilometre | Iceland |
| 2010s | 38,893 US dollar per square kilometre | 88,172 US dollar per square kilometre | 49,279 US dollar per square kilometre | Iceland |
| 2020s | 51,957 US dollar per square kilometre | 49,825 US dollar per square kilometre | 2,132 US dollar per square kilometre | Cambodia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Other investment, Debt instruments (Assets, Positions, US dollar)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
